With all teams eliminated in their respective districts from the playoffs, all-district honor announcements are coming out. There was no shortage of athletes included from Bryson, Graham and Newcastle The Cowboys were represented by nine players and the Bobcats were represented by six players in 9-1AI. The Steers had 20 players named for all-district honors in 3-4AII.


Bryson Cowboys: Justin Justin, junior (first team tight end, first team defensive lineman); Chris Harris, senior (first team linebacker), Tyce Reeves, junior (first team corner back, academic); Ragen Register, junior (second team tight end, second team defensive lineman); Drake Huffman, junior (second team wide receiver); Grayson Allen, junior (second team spread center); TJ Imotichey, junior (second team full back); Landon Stephens, junior (second team spread back); Taylor Tyson, senior (special teams); Marcus Espinoza, junior (second team safety); Josh Leatherwood, senior (second team utility player); Zander Tinney, junior (honorable mention).


Graham Steers: Daniel Gilbertson, junior (offensive most valuable player); Bryce Hernandez, senior (offensive line co-most valuable player); Jesus “Gordo” Renteria, senior (defensive line most valuable player); J.J. Lee, junior (co-utility player of the year). First team all-district: Mathrew Linquist, Corey Ballew, Zach Martin, Hunter Lanham, Raider Horn, Greg Simenal, Landon Hebert, Lars Hanssen(offensive line). Second team all-district: Trey Overcast, Salvador Mendez, Ethan Hughes, Nick Helm, Lars Hanssen (defensive end), Brant Coley, Armando Anaya. Honorable mention: Brody Rogers.


Newcastle Bobcats: JD Brice, senior (offensive most valuable player); Lane Brice, senior (first team wide receiver, first team safety); Cash Strawbridge, sophomore (first team spread center); JT Spurlin, senior (first team running back, second team linebacker); Ryan Blair, sophomore (second team kicker); Jacob McMillan, senior (second team corner back).
